Transaction 145761016e10c50857ceeb257b402f149dd7a6e66ead1c79c3f45e685592759e

1 Input
2 Outputs
  • 145761016e10c50857ceeb257b402f149dd7a6e66ead1c79c3f45e685592759e:0
  • value  3229552
    address  3Ct1XkQSoQa6R3xSy5S44PWi6Kb1W9AebG
  • 145761016e10c50857ceeb257b402f149dd7a6e66ead1c79c3f45e685592759e:1
  • value  268646
    address  3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r